EDELWEISS

edelweiss, Leontopodium alpinum

(noun) alpine perennial plant native to Europe having leaves covered with whitish down and small flower heads held in stars of glistening whitish bracts

Source: WordNet® 3.1

edelweiss (usually uncountable, plural edelweisses)

A European perennial alpine plant, Leontopodium alpinum, with downy leaves and small white flower heads in a dense cluster.

Source: Wiktionary


E"del*weiss, n. Etym: [G., fr. edel noble + weiss white.] (Bot.)

Definition: A little, perennial, white, woolly plant (Leontopodium alpinum), growing at high elevations in the Alps.
